Project Description:
A tachometer is an instrument measuring the rotation speed of a shaft or disk, as in a motor or
other machine. Tachometers are the instrument that indicates the speed, usually in revolutions per
minute (rpm), at which an engine shaft or motor is rotating. Some tachometers, especially those
used in automobiles, are similar in construction and operation to automotive speedometers. Other
types, often connected directly to the shaft whose speed they indicate, are small electric generators
whose output voltage is proportional to the speed. This voltage is applied to a voltmeter whose
dial is calibrated in speed units. Another type, it is used only with engines having an ignition
system, operates by counting the pulsations of current or voltage in the ignition system, the number
of these being proportional to the speed of the shaft. There are two types of tachometer in the
market, which is analog, and digital tachometer. In this case, digital tachometer has been proposed.

Working:
The digital tachometer circuit is as shown in the figure. It is composed of the disk with the
permanent magnet, the Hall integrated sensor, the selective passing gate circuit, the time base
signal circuit, the power count circuit and the digital display circuit. The count circuit and the
digital display circuits use the 7 segment display LED, and display the numerical code. The input
shaft of the turntable is connected with the measured rotating shaft, when the measured rotating
shaft is rotating, it will drive the turntable to turn with it. When the small permanent magnet of the
turntable is getting through the Hall integrated sensor IC1, will change the magnetic signal into
the speed electric signal. This signal reverse-phase inputs to the input port of the NAND gate 3
through the NAND gate and further The MC14553B 3digit BCD counter consists of 3 negative
edge triggered BCD counters that are cascaded synchronously.
Frequency Divider
This type of counter circuit used for frequency division is commonly known as an Asynchronous
3-bit Binary Counter as the output on QA to QC, which is 3 bits wide, is a binary count from 0 to
7 for each clock pulse. In an asynchronous counter, the clock is applied only to the first stage with
the output of one flip-flop stage providing the clocking signal for the next flip-flop stage and
subsequent stages derive the clock from the previous stage with the clock pulse being halved by
each stage.
